What Is Refractive Lens Exchange (RLE) and Exactly How Does It Function?
Refractive Lens Exchange (RLE) is a procedure focused on fixing vision troubles by changing the eye's natural lens with a fabricated one.
Throughout the treatment, your eye specialist makes a small laceration and removes your existing lens. They after that place a tailored intraocular lens (IOL) customized to your particular vision needs.
This procedure not only addresses refractive errors like nearsightedness however additionally alleviates problems related to cataracts.
RLE commonly takes regarding 15-30 minutes per eye and is done under regional anesthetic for your convenience.
After the surgery, you'll appreciate a quicker recovery time compared to typical cataract surgical procedure.
It's vital to follow your doctor's post-operative directions for optimal results and a smooth recovery process.
The Advantages of RLE for Managing High Nearsightedness
If you're battling with high nearsightedness, RLE offers an appealing service that can dramatically improve your vision. This treatment changes your eye's natural lens with a man-made one, enabling an extra specific modification of your refractive mistakes.
Unlike traditional methods like glasses or get in touches with, RLE addresses the hidden concern directly, supplying clearer vision at numerous distances.
Additionally, RLE can decrease your dependancy on corrective eyewear, offering you the flexibility to appreciate day-to-day activities without hassle.
You'll additionally benefit from a lower risk of creating cataracts later on in life, as RLE changes the lens prior to age-related changes take place.
With a quick healing time, several patients experience improved vision within days, making RLE an attractive option for taking care of high myopia.
